R () is an extensive statistical environment and programming language for Qualified info Examination and graphical Exhibit.
In Personal computer programming, an assignment assertion sets and/or re-sets the worth stored from the storage location(s) denoted by a variable identify; To put it differently, it copies a value into the variable.
graphics command and so are selected determined by the provided facts. The place x and y arguments are essential, Additionally it is
a project (i.e. in the setting up phase, where by we are now), all you need to know is always that it is totally essential for making practical choices for the outset. If you do not, your project may be doomed to failure of incessant rounds of refactoring.
Making deals is nice practice with regards to Studying to correctly doc your code, retail store case in point knowledge, as well as (by means of vignettes) ensure reproducibility. Nevertheless it might take lots of time beyond regulation so should not be taken flippantly. This approach to R workflow is suitable for controlling complex projects which frequently use the exact same routines that may be converted into functions.
A demanding method of project management and workflow is treating your projects as R offers. This method has rewards and limitations. The most important threat with managing a project for a package deal would be that the offer is fairly a demanding technique for organising operate. Packages are suited for code intense projects wherever code documentation is vital.
It is truly worth noting that although the compiler performs form inference on regional variables, it doesn't complete any type of form inference on fields, always slipping again why not try these out into the declared style of a field. For example this, Enable’s Look into this example:
Hi, This really is Abhishek Kumar. And welcome to the ninth module on R Programming Fundamentals, that's on importing facts in R. That is also the 1st module in the info Evaluation part. For any info Investigation project making use of R, we to start with need to bring all necessary info from the R atmosphere in order that we can Focus on them.
one example is) into a variety that The actual device can understand. System drivers are begun by contacting a tool driver functionality. There
This chapter concentrates on workflow. For project scheduling and management, we’ll make use of the DiagrammeR deal. For project reporting we’ll concentrate on R Markdown and knitr which might be bundled with RStudio (but can be mounted independently if wanted).
Even though R is really an open up-supply project supported via the Neighborhood acquiring it, some companies try to deliver business assist and/or extensions for his or her shoppers. This segment offers some examples of these kinds of businesses.
On the other hand, as we continue I provides you with numerous examples of capabilities through the use of R's exception managing ability. If you need a far more comprehensive remedy of R exception handling, I like to recommend you read through the applicable sections of your reserve by Wickham shown in Appendix B - More Reading through.
Welcome to 7 days two of R Programming. This week, we take the gloves off, plus the lectures address essential topics like Management structures and capabilities. We also introduce the main programming assignment for the class, which is owing at the end of the week.
If The solution to each of those issues is ‘Certainly’, the task is likely to be ideal to include inside the project’s prepare.